RICKY SHEILA While wedding trends change every year, there’s something so everlasting about a gold and white wedding. It’s a color scheme that is simple, yet timeless and never goes out of style and is both elegant and contemporary. This wedding was held in two cities, Bandung and Jakarta. Here's our design for the simple celebration lunch held for their friends and colleagues in Jakarta. The concept is simple, using white gold and soft pink to bring everlasting and romantic style. The curvy structure on the background makes the whole set up look dynamic, minimalist, and effortlessly modern at the same time. Adding natural elements like dried flowers and leaves alongside with white and gold ornaments for your wedding table centerpieces brings elegance and natural touch at the same time. With curvy walls (even almost cylindrical!), this photo gallery was totally unique. It is a common view in Chinese Tradition to do a Tea Ceremony. Where family members gathered on that special day. A chance for the married couple to pay their tribute by presenting tea in a special cup to the eldest family member to the youngest. For the Tea Ceremony decoration you can always go for a simple one, but of course there has to be this double happiness symbol no matter what. Classic! You'd like something a little more timeless.
